AutoLign Manufacturing, independent aftermarket manufacturer of bumper covers for collision replacement in North America, now offers an expanded web site for customer use. In addition to detailed information about AutoLign and the company's manufacturing facility, the web site has a full application guide listing all the replacement bumper covers the company manufacturers and what vehicles they fit. This list is continually being updated with new applications.
AutoLign has earned a reputation for premium quality by using sophisticated manufacturing processes, tooling and materials. For example, the company has nine thermoplastic olefin (TPO) injection molding machines, considered an advanced technology. AutoLign also has seven high-pressure reaction injection molding (RIM) machines with an automated injection process that orients parts in three dimensions. A video stream tour of these operations can be seen on the web site. AutoLign follows a diligent quality control process during mold making to ensure that all parts produced from a mold are up to exacting quality standards. The company goes one step further by test fitting their pre-production parts on actual vehicles to fine tune each mold for a premium quality fit. This test fitting is also demonstrated on the web site in a video stream. A top-quality collision repair job begins where AutoLign leaves off - at the end of the paint line. All bumper covers pass though one of two of AutoLign's custom-designed primer paint lines - one dedicated for each injection department before they are inspected, wrapped and shipped to body shop's around the country.
